Very pretty and impressive elm and ivory serving tray. The top is made of solid wood on which an ivory bird is placed on a mound carved from the mass. A leafy branch forming part of the decor is also in ivory. A gilded bronze handle on each side completes the object. This tray represents the know-how of Japanese artisans. Very good state. Period: Japan - Meiji era (1868 - 1912) Around 1900 Dimensions: Length: 65 cm; width: 47 cm; Height: 4 cm.
